About Me

As a family medicine physician at The Ohio State University Wexner Medical Center, I treat patients with asthma, exercise induced asthma, athletic injuries, diabetes and hypertension. I also specialize in adolescent medicine and pediatrics, travel medicine, preconception care, contraception, medical education and health promotion. I think it’s important for patients to establish a relationship with a family physician they can trust.

I have a special interest in preventive medicine and vaccinations. I strongly promote preventive health with my patients in order to keep them from getting too sick in the first place. I believe that family medicine is the cornerstone of good healthcare. As family medicine physicians, we provide a basic service that everyone needs.

My favorite part about working at Ohio State is the opportunity to work with and teach medical students. It’s also a great location with good benefits.

When I’m not working, I enjoy traveling, cooking and spending time with my children.

Consulting and Related Relationships

At The Ohio State University Wexner Medical Center, we support a faculty member’s research and consulting in collaboration with medical device, research and/or drug companies because a faculty member’s expertise can guide important advancements in the practice of medicine and improve patient care. In order to provide effective management of these relationships, the University requires annual disclosures from all faculty members with external interests related to their University responsibilities.

As of 09/30/2024, Dr. Farrell has reported no relationships with companies or entities.
